The Lung Cancer Score in 20622, Charlotte Hall, Maryland is 33 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

89.17 percent of the population in 20622 drive to work alone. 1.33 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 25.42 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 30.42 percent of the residents in 20622 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 3.65 members with about 2.51 cars available per household.

An estimate of 79.60 percent of the residents in 20622 has some form of health insurance. 23.66 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 64.08 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 20622 would have to travel an average of 9.13 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, University Of Md Charles Regional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 20622, Charlotte Hall, Maryland.

As of , an estimate of 6,005 residents live in 20622 with a median age of 40.3 years. 25.45 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 14.59 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 36.63 percent of the residents in 20622 is currently married, and 22.67 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 20622 is $9,583.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 20622 is approximately $1,811. The median household spends about 18.90 percent of their income on housing.

In addition to medical facilities and transportation options, potential movers should consider the historical significance of Charlotte Hall when evaluating the desirability of this community. Originally established as a land grant known as "Sutton," Charlotte Hall has a rich history dating back to the late 17th century when it served as an important crossroads settlement.

Today, Charlotte Hall is known for its historic sites and landmarks that reflect its colonial heritage. The Dr. Samuel A. Mudd House Museum is one such attraction that draws visitors interested in learning about local history. Dr. Mudd was a prominent figure in American history and became infamous for his involvement in treating John Wilkes Booth after President Abraham Lincoln's assassination.
